AIにできないこと
以前、「300字で自己PRを書いて」とChatGPTにお願いしたところ、文字数が正確でなかったという経験をしました。
最近はそういうのが改善されているのかを調べてみました。
方法
以下の塩基配列をテキストファイルに保存し、Copilot (Smart GPT-5.1)にアップロードして、「この塩基配列の長さを教えてください。4個のヌクレオチドの数も教えてください。」と質問しました。
Copilotの回答
ファイルを読み取りました。
配列は問題なく取得できたので、全長と A/T/G/C のカウントを正確に算出しました。
配列は問題なく取得できたので、全長と A/T/G/C のカウントを正確に算出しました。
配列の統計結果(seq.txt)
全長 (bp)
2,907 bp
塩基ごとのカウント
| 塩基 | 個数 |
|---|---|
| A | 1,020 |
| T | 1,094 |
| G | 402 |
| C | 391 |
感想
正解は、全長が2547 bpで、塩基はA: 727、T: 899、G: 488、G: 433です。
AIは「なんとなくこのぐらいかな」という答えを返します。なので、きちんと計算できるものは間違えます。
Copilotに「塩基を数えるExcelの数式を教えて。」と入力すると、以下のように完璧な解答をくれます。
以下では、塩基配列がセル A1 に入っていると仮定します。
=LEN(A1) – LEN(SUBSTITUTE(A1, “A", “"))
=LEN(A1) – LEN(SUBSTITUTE(A1, “A", “"))
今のところ、AIには考え方を聞いて、それを自分でやることが必要です。